What Makes a Great Desk with a Keyboard Tray
A keyboard tray is not just a shelf bolted under your desktop. The good ones slide smoothly, lock in place, and sit a couple of inches below the main surface. That drop keeps your wrists in a neutral position instead of bending upward while you type. Before you compare specific models, it helps to understand the features that actually matter.
Tray Style and Ergonomics
Look for a tray with a slight negative tilt or at least a flat, stable glide track. Trays that wobble under normal typing pressure will bother you within a week. Deeper trays fit a full-size keyboard and mouse pad side by side, which matters if you use a numpad. If you already deal with wrist or shoulder strain, prioritize a tray that adjusts independently of desk height.
Desk Shape: Straight, L-Shaped, or Standing
Straight desks work best in tight bedrooms or apartments where floor space is limited. L-shaped desks give you a separate zone for a printer or paperwork, which is handy if you juggle side projects. Standing desks add height adjustment on top of the tray, so you can alternate between sitting and standing throughout the day. Your choice here should follow how you actually work, not just what looks impressive in photos.

Materials, Storage, and Cable Management to Consider
Beyond the tray itself, the materials and extras separate a desk that lasts from one that wobbles within months. Solid engineered wood with a thick top resists sagging better than thin particleboard, especially once you add a monitor arm. Built-in drawers or open shelves reduce desktop clutter, which keeps your keyboard tray area clear for actual typing.
Cable management matters more than most buyers expect until they are staring at a tangle of cords. Grommet holes, under-desk trays, or basket-style organizers keep power strips and charging cables out of your legroom. If you plan to run a monitor light bar, dock, or multiple chargers, pick a desk with at least one dedicated cable channel.
Common Mistakes to Avoid When Buying a Keyboard Tray Desk
A few buying mistakes come up again and again with this category, and they are easy to avoid once you know what to check.
- Skipping the tray depth measurement, then finding your mouse pad does not fit alongside a full keyboard.
- Ignoring weight capacity on standing desks, which matters if you run dual monitors or a heavy monitor arm.
- Choosing a fixed-height tray when you already have wrist or shoulder discomfort that needs independent adjustment.
- Overlooking assembly complexity, especially for L-shaped and electric standing models with more hardware.
- Buying based on looks alone without checking desktop thickness, which affects long-term sag under monitor weight.
Setting Up Your Keyboard Tray for Comfort
Once your desk arrives, spend a few minutes dialing in the tray height before you start a full workday on it. Your elbows should sit close to 90 degrees with wrists flat, not angled up or down while typing. If the tray sits too low, your shoulders will round forward within an hour, which compounds into fatigue by afternoon. Small adjustments now save you from discomfort later, and they cost nothing but a few minutes.
Pair your tray height with your chair and monitor position for the full ergonomic picture. A tray that is perfectly adjusted still will not help much if your chair pushes you too high or too low relative to the desk. Frequently Asked Questions
Do keyboard trays actually reduce wrist strain?
Yes, when set at the right height, a keyboard tray keeps your wrists flatter than typing directly on the desktop. The lower position aligns your forearms closer to a neutral angle. Combined with a supportive chair, it is one of the simplest upgrades for daily typing comfort.
Are L-shaped desks with keyboard trays harder to assemble?
They generally take longer than a straight desk because of the extra panel and corner bracket. Most kits still ship with clear instructions and take under an hour with two people. Electric standing versions add slightly more wiring but are rarely difficult.
What weight capacity do I need for a standing desk with a keyboard tray?
For a single monitor and laptop, 100 to 150 pounds of capacity is usually plenty. If you run dual monitors, a monitor arm, and a docking station, look for capacity closer to 150 pounds or more. Check the listed capacity before adding heavy accessories.
Can a keyboard tray fit an ergonomic split keyboard?
Most standard trays fit split and compact keyboards without issue since they are usually narrower than full-size boards. Measure your keyboard’s width against the tray’s listed dimensions if it is unusually wide. A deeper tray also gives you room for a wrist rest.
Is a fixed keyboard tray good enough, or should I get an adjustable one?
A fixed tray works fine if your desk height already suits your seating position. If you switch chairs often or share the desk with another person, an adjustable tray adapts more easily. It is a small cost difference for meaningfully better comfort over time.
